Add 45/30 and 6/16
1st number: 1 15/30, 2nd number: 6/16
45/30 + 6/16 is 15/8.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 30 and 16 is 240
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 240 - For the 1st fraction, since 30 × 8 = 240,
45/30 = 45 × 8/30 × 8 = 360/240 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 16 × 15 = 240,
6/16 = 6 × 15/16 × 15 = 90/240 - Add the two like fractions:
360/240 + 90/240 = 360 + 90/240 = 450/240 - 450/240 simplified gives 15/8
- So, 45/30 + 6/16 = 15/8
